Symfony2とSonata管理バンドルでテンプレートエラーを取得します
-
28-10-2019 - |
質問
行くときにソナタ管理バンドルとソナタユーザーバンドルをインストールしました
/admin/dashboard
リスト]ユーザーをクリックして、このエラーが発生します
Sonatauserbundle:admin:field/imsonating.html.twigのテンプレート(「ルート」ホームページ "は存在しない」のレンダリング中に例外がスローされています。
何をする必要がありますか
他のすべてのバンドルソナタページ、ニュースは大丈夫です
解決
私はこのバンドルを使用していませんが、おそらく「ホームページ」という名前のホームページコントローラーアクションを実装する必要があります。ソナタはおそらくこのルートを使用して、自分自身を実装するために必要なメインページにアクセスしました!
他のヒント
あなたが持っている場合:
# app/config/routing.yml
...
sonata_user_impersonating:
pattern: /
defaults: { _controller: SonataPageBundle:Page:catchAll }
追加するだけです
# app/config/config.yml
...
sonata_user:
impersonating_route: sonata_user_impersonating
所属していません StackOverflow